DESCRIPTION
The TSSP57P38 is a compact infrared detector module for
proximity sensing application. It receives 38 kHz modulated
signals and has a peak sensitivity of 940 nm.
The length of the detector's output pulse varies in proportion
to the amount of light reflected from the object being
detected.

FEATURES
• Height of 0.8 mm
• Up to 2 m for proximity sensing
• Receives 38 kHz modulated signal
• Photo detector and preamplifier in one package
• Low supply current
• Shielding against EMI
• Visible light is suppressed by IR filter
• Insensitive to supply voltage ripple and noise
• Supply voltage: 2.5 V to 5.5 V

APPLICATIONS
• Object approach detection for activation of displays and
user consoles, signaling of alarms, etc.
• Simple gesture controls
• Differentiation of car arrival, static, car departure in
parking lots
• Reflective sensors for toilet flush
• Navigational sensor for robotics

  • Page 5 Vishay Semiconductors The typical application of the TSSP57P38 is a reflective sensor with analog information contained in its output. Such a sensor is evaluating the time required by the AGC to suppress a quasi continuous signal. The time required to suppress such a signal is longer when the signal is strong than when the signal is weak, resulting in a pulse length corresponding to the distance of an object from the sensor.
